Extremely heavy rain warning for 5 districts, wet spell till July 30

Monday, 26 July 2021 | PNS | Dehradun

The State meteorological centre has forecast a wet spell in the state till July 30. During this five-day period, some parts of the state are expected to receive extremely heavy rainfall.

On Sunday the meteorological centre issued a warning regarding the possibility of extremely heavy rainfall at isolated places in Pithoragarh, Bageshwar, Nainital, Pauri and Dehradun districts on Monday.  The warning is in addition to the alert issued regarding the likelihood of heavy to very heavy rainfall with intense spells at isolated places in the state on Monday. Apart from this, light to moderate rain/thundershowers are likely to occur at most places in the state. For the provisional state capital Dehradun, the state meteorological centre has forecast few spells of rain/thundershowers, one or two of which may be heavy in some areas. The maximum and minimum temperatures are likely to be about 27 degrees Celsius and 24 degrees Celsius respectively in Dehradun today. Further, according to officials, the current meteorological analysis and numerical weather prediction models indicate that the western end of the monsoon trough is likely to shift north of its normal position from July 25 and remain close to the foothills of the western Himalaya till July 30. With the monsoon trough likely to remain active during this period, widespread rainfall activities are likely under its influence over Uttarakhand till July 30.

Apart from the weather warning issued for today, the meteorological centre has also warned of the possibility of extremely heavy rainfall at isolated places in Dehradun, Pithoragarh, Bageshwar, Nainital and Pauri districts on Tuesday. Further, heavy to very heavy rainfall with intense spells is likely to occur at isolated places especially in Uttarkashi, Dehradun, Tehri, Pauri, Nainital and Pithoragarh districts on July 28, 29 and 30.
